Patio jacking is a service that involves lifting and leveling sunken or uneven concrete slabs in outdoor patio areas. Over time, patios can settle due to soil movement, moisture changes, or poor initial installation. When a patio begins to sink or develop uneven spots, it can create tripping hazards, make outdoor spaces less enjoyable, and even cause damage to the concrete. Professional patio jacking uses specialized tools and techniques to lift the slabs back to a proper level, restoring the safety and appearance of the outdoor space without the need for complete replacement.
This service helps solve common problems associated with sunken or uneven patios, such as water pooling, cracking, and shifting. When the surface of a patio is uneven, water can collect in low spots, leading to further deterioration or even basement or foundation issues in nearby structures. Cracks and shifting slabs not only detract from the visual appeal but can also pose safety risks for family and guests. By addressing these issues through patio jacking, property owners can prevent more costly repairs down the line and maintain a stable, attractive outdoor environment.

The overview below groups typical Patio Jacking proj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Palm Bay, FL.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- For minor patio jacking or leveling, local contractors typically charge between $250 and $600. Many routine jobs fall within this range, especially for straightforward adjustments or fixes. Larger or more complex repairs may cost more, but these are less common.
Mid-Range Projects - Larger patio jacking projects or moderate repairs usually range from $600 to $1,500. Many projects that involve leveling multiple sections or addressing foundational issues often fall into this band. Fewer jobs reach into the higher end of this range.
Full Patio Replacement - Complete patio replacement or extensive foundation work can cost between $2,000 and $5,000 or more. These larger projects are less frequent but are necessary for severely damaged or sinking patios requiring extensive work.
Complex or Custom Work - Highly specialized or custom patio jacking projects, especially those involving difficult access or unique designs, can exceed $5,000. Such jobs are typically less common and are tailored to specific needs of the property in Palm Bay, FL area.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is patio jacking? Patio jacking is a process that lifts and stabilizes sunken or uneven patios using specialized equipment, helping to restore their level appearance and structural integrity.
How do local contractors perform patio jacking? Contractors typically insert hydraulic piers or supports beneath the patio, then carefully lift and stabilize the surface to prevent further settling or damage.
Is patio jacking suitable for all types of patios? Patio jacking is generally effective for concrete, stone, or paver patios that have experienced sinking or shifting, but a professional assessment can determine the best approach.
What are common signs that patio jacking may be needed? Signs include uneven surfaces, cracks, or a noticeable slope that affects the patio’s safety and usability.
